import torch
from torch import nn
import torch.nn.functional as F
import MLP
from configure import device
r"""
Construct subgraph for a polyline.
"""
class SubGraph(nn.Module):
r"""
Subgraph of VectorNet. This network accept a number of initiated vectors belong to
the same polyline, flow three layers of network, then output this polyline's feature vector.
"""
def __init__(self, len, layersNumber):
r"""
Given all vectors of this polyline, we should build a 3-layers subgraph network,
get the output which is the polyline's feature vector.
:param len: the length of vector.
:param layersNumber: the number of subgraph network.
"""
super(SubGraph, self).__init__()
self.layers = nn.ModuleList([SubGraphLayer(len),
SubGraphLayer(len * (2 ** 1)),
SubGraphLayer(len * (2 ** 2))])
# self.layers = nn.ModuleList([SubGraphLayer(len),
# SubGraphLayer(len),
# SubGraphLayer(len)])
def forward(self, x):
r"""
:param x: a number of vectors. x.shape=[batch size, vNumber, len].
:return: The vector of this polyline. Shape is [batch size, output len].
"""
# x = torch.tensor(
# [[[1,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0],
# [1, 2, 3, 1, -1, -2, -3, -1, 1],
# [3, 2, 1, 2, 3, 1, -1, -2, -3]],
#
# [[0, 0, 0, 0, 2, 1, 2, 3, 1],
# [1, 3, 2, 1, 3, 1, -1, -2, -3],
# [3, 3, 3, 2, 0, 0, 0, 2, 1]]]).float().to(device)
for layer in self.layers:
# print('sub graph !!!')
x = layer(x)
# x's shape is [batch size, vNumber, output len]
# print(x)
#
# import numpy as np
# y = torch.zeros(x.shape[0], x.shape[2])
# for i in range(x.shape[0]):
# for j in range(x.shape[1]):
# for k in range(x.shape[2]):
# y[i, k] = np.max([y[i, k], x[i, j, k]])
x = x.permute(0, 2, 1) # [batch size, output len, vNumber]
x = F.max_pool1d(x, kernel_size=x.shape[2]) # [batch size, output len, 1]
x = x.permute(0, 2, 1) # [batch size, 1, output len]
x.squeeze_(1)
# print(x)
#
# for i in range(y.shape[0]):
# for j in range(y.shape[1]):
# print(y[i, j], x[i, j], y[i, j] == x[i, j])
# exit(0)
return x
class SubGraphLayer(nn.Module):
r"""
One layer of subgraph, include the MLP of g_enc.
The calculation detail in this paper's 3.2 section.
Input some vectors with 'len' length, the output's length is '2*len'(because of
concat operator).
"""
def __init__(self, len):
r"""
:param len: the length of input vector.
"""
super(SubGraphLayer, self).__init__()
self.g_enc = MLP.MLP(len, len)
# self.decD = MLP.MLP(2*len, len)
def forward(self, x):
r"""
:param x: A number of vectors. x.shape = [batch size, vNumber, len]
:return: All processed vectors with shape [batch size, vNumber, len*2]
"""
# print(x)
x = self.g_enc(x)
batchSize, vNumber, len = x.shape
x = x.permute(1, 0, 2) # [vNumber, batch size, len]
mp = x.permute(1, 2, 0)
mp = F.max_pool1d(mp, kernel_size=mp.shape[2]) # [batch size, len, 1]
# print(x.shape)
# print(mp.shape)
mp = torch.cat([mp] * vNumber, dim=2) # [batch size, len, vNumber]
# print(mp.shape)
y = torch.cat((mp.permute(0, 2, 1), x.permute(1, 0, 2)), dim=2)
# y = torch.zeros(batchSize, 0, len * 2).to(device)
# for i in range(x.shape[0]):
# L, tmp, R = torch.split(x, [i, 1, x.shape[0] - i - 1], dim=0)
# L = L.to(device)
# R = R.to(device)
#
# # print('sub graph layer 1', i, L.shape, tmp.shape, R.shape)
# # tmp's shape is [1, batch size, len]
#
# t = torch.cat((L, R), dim=0) # [vNumber-1, batch size, len]
#
# if t.shape[0] == 0:
# t = torch.zeros(batchSize, len, 1).to(device)
# else:
# t = t.permute(1, 2, 0) # [batch size, len, vNumber-1]
# t = F.max_pool1d(t, kernel_size=t.shape[2]) # [batch size, len, 1] agg
# tmp.squeeze_(0)
# t.squeeze_(2)
# tmp = torch.cat((tmp, t), dim = 1) # [batch size, len * 2] rel
# tmp = tmp.unsqueeze(1)
# y = torch.cat((y, tmp), dim = 1)
# y's shape is [batch size, vNumber, len * 2]
# print('y\'s shape',y.shape)
# y = self.decD(y)
return y
